
com.groupbyinc.flux.common.apache.commons.cli.OptionGroup.class Maven / Gradle / Ivy
???? 1 ? 9com/groupbyinc/flux/common/apache/commons/cli/OptionGroup java/lang/Object java/io/Serializable OptionGroup.java serialVersionUID J optionMap Ljava/util/Map; YLjava/util/Map; selected Ljava/lang/String; required Z ()V
java/util/HashMap
this ;Lcom/groupbyinc/flux/common/apache/commons/cli/OptionGroup; addOption s(Lcom/groupbyinc/flux/common/apache/commons/cli/Option;)Lcom/groupbyinc/flux/common/apache/commons/cli/OptionGroup; 4com/groupbyinc/flux/common/apache/commons/cli/Option getKey ()Ljava/lang/String; " #
! $
java/util/Map & put 8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; ( ) ' * option 6Lcom/groupbyinc/flux/common/apache/commons/cli/Option; getNames ()Ljava/util/Collection; keySet ()Ljava/util/Set; 0 1 ' 2
getOptions values 5 / ' 6 setSelected 9(Lcom/groupbyinc/flux/common/apache/commons/cli/Option;)V Fcom/groupbyinc/flux/common/apache/commons/cli/AlreadySelectedException : < java/lang/String > equals (Ljava/lang/Object;)Z @ A
? B t(Lcom/groupbyinc/flux/common/apache/commons/cli/OptionGroup;Lcom/groupbyinc/flux/common/apache/commons/cli/Option;)V D
; E getSelected setRequired (Z)V J
isRequired ()Z toString java/lang/StringBuilder O
P 4 /
R java/util/Collection T iterator ()Ljava/util/Iterator; V W U X [ Z append -(Ljava/lang/String;)Ljava/lang/StringBuilder; \ ]
P ^ java/util/Iterator ` hasNext b M a c next ()Ljava/lang/Object; e f a g getOpt i #
! j - l -- n
getLongOpt p #
! q getDescription s #
! t v , x ] z N #
P | buff Ljava/lang/StringBuilder; iter LLjava/util/Iterator; Ljava/util/Iterator;
ConstantValue Signature Code LocalVariableTable LineNumberTable ,()Ljava/util/Collection; P()Ljava/util/Collection;
Exceptions LocalVariableTypeTable
SourceFile ! ?
? ? > *? *? Y? ? ? ? ?
% ? I *? +? %+? + W*? ? , - ?
7 9 . / ? 4
*? ? 3 ? ?
? C ? ? 4 / ? 4
*? ? 7 ? ?
? L ? ? 8 9 ? ? 5+? *? =?*? =? *? =+? %? C? *+? %? =?
? ;Y*+? F?? ? 5 5 , - ? X [ \
b d * h 4 j ? ; G # ? / *? =? ? ? q H I ? > *? K? ? ?
y z L M ? / *? K? ? ? ? N # ? * ?? PY? QL*? S? Y M+[? _W,? d ? a,? h ? !N-? k? +m? _W+-? k? _W? +o? _W+-? r? _W-? u? +w? _W+-? u? _W,? d ?
+y? _W???+{? _W+? }? ? * , Q , - ? ? ~ z ? ? ? z ? ? ? J ? ? ? ? " ? , ? 3 ? : ? F ? M ? V ? ] ? d ? m ? v ? } ? ? ? ? ? ?
© 2015 - 2025 Weber Informatics LLC | Privacy Policy